QUARTERLY PLANNING NOTE — For the Incoming Director

Pricing for the Veltrix appliance line requires careful attention this quarter. Margins on the mid-range units have narrowed since Drossman & Hale undercut us in the Kellwick region, and our list prices have not moved in fourteen months. Finance recommends a modest repositioning rather than across-the-board increases. The broader strategy informing these adjustments is set out in the confidential note below.

board note of bawep-tajef: Queniusek Systems plans to raise the Quenvan list price by 53.1 percent in March. The pricing group signed off on a budget of $176.4 million for Project Drueth. The renewal with Casionix Partners closes at $142.5 million a year, 8.3 percent below the last contract. Project Fraax slips by six weeks because of the tooling delay.

Handover for the weekly eng sync: I'm transferring ownership of Duskrunner, our nightly backfill scheduler, to Priya. Current state: all jobs healthy except the ledger-reconciliation backfill, which retries once nightly due to a slow upstream from the Kestwick warehouse. Retry logic, window sizing, and concurrency caps were all tuned carefully last quarter — please don't change them without a load test. For full transparency at the sync, the production instance runs with these configuration values.

settings of hawep-kadug:
RALAEL_HOST=ralael.tolvaqlabs.internal
RALAEL_PORT=9000

The garage occupancy feed for the Brindlewood campus arrives over a message queue every thirty seconds, one record per level, published by the Stallgrid edge boxes. Counts can briefly go negative when a sensor double-fires on exit; the ingest job clamps these to zero and flags the interval. If the feed stalls for more than five minutes, the dashboard falls back to the last known snapshot. Sensor mappings, queue names, and the replay procedure are documented on the internal page below.

runbook for tahog-kadug: https://gitlab.qirvanworks.corp/projects/pages/view/b139298aed28